Megalopolis at our fingers.


We race to see each of us

Live our lives, never seeming

To loose our grip enough

So we don’t keep running in place.


Faces sag quicker than 

They used to. 

Know more people

Except ourselves. 


The hermit in us is unfed, 

The tyrant in us

Seeking to expand it’s ever

Hungry reach outwards,

Destroying creation itself.


The hermit the only chance 

for peace. Insanity incentivized.


The corruption of tyranny, seeking

To spread it’s seed across the web

Of humanity, until we all drone

In His Image.
